How they compare
El Salvador currently reports 73.86 against 70.1 in United Republic of Tanzania, a difference of 3.76.
That makes El Salvador's figure about 1.1 times United Republic of Tanzania's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2005 it was El Salvador ahead.
El Salvador ranks 74th and United Republic of Tanzania ranks 75th of 145 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, El Salvador averaged higher in 2 and United Republic of Tanzania in 1.
